The Costa del Sol offers an array of sought-after destinations, but two locations are most frequently named as highlights of this appealing part of southern Spain – Marbella and Estepona. Both enjoy the same outstanding year-round climate, sandy Blue Flag beaches and easy access to Málaga’s international airport hub, yet they appeal in different ways. Choosing between them is less about which is better and more about which way of life best reflects your vision of living by the Mediterranean.
Marbella
Marbella has long been regarded as the cosmopolitan centre of the Costa del Sol. Its atmosphere is international, shaped by a community that blends locals with residents from all over the world. The result is a lively and sophisticated cultural calendar, from art exhibitions and music festivals to gourmet dining and luxury shopping. Marbella is not just a holiday resort but a thriving, modern city, with a level of infrastructure that makes it highly practical for year-round living.
Property in Marbella reflects its international reputation for quality and luxury. The market is diverse, with stylish apartments by the sea, elegant townhouses and expansive villas in exclusive gated communities. Prices are among the highest on the coast, but the strength of the Marbella brand ensures lasting value. For those seeking prestige and proven demand, Marbella remains a benchmark.
Leisure here is defined by choice. The Golden Mile, lined with five-star hotels and fine restaurants, epitomises the town’s glamour, while Puerto Banús remains a magnet for high-end fashion and dining by the marina. Beyond its famous nightlife and shopping, Marbella is also a leading centre for golf, sailing, tennis and wellness. Few destinations combine such variety so close at hand.
Services in Marbella are extensive. International schools, private healthcare facilities and excellent road connections make it a convenient base for families and professionals alike. Its size and scale mean that everything from luxury retail to specialist medical care is readily available.
Marbella is dynamic and outward-looking. It appeals to those who enjoy variety, energy and cosmopolitan connections, while still benefiting from the relaxed setting of the Mediterranean coast.
Estepona
Estepona has emerged in recent years as one of the most desirable towns on the Costa del Sol, finding it leaning deeply into its Andalucian heritage. The atmosphere is more traditional, with a historic centre full of whitewashed houses and streets decorated with colourful flowerpots. Life here moves at a slower pace, shaped by local markets, tapas bars and the evening paseo along the wide, family-friendly promenade. Estepona combines a sense of authenticity with a growing reputation as a stylish place to live.
The property market has become one of the most dynamic in southern Spain. Values have risen steadily, although homes still remain more accessible than in Marbella. Buyers can choose from charming townhouses in the Old Town to modern apartments in newly built developments, many designed with sustainability and contemporary architecture in mind. For those seeking growth potential, Estepona offers a compelling proposition.
Leisure in Estepona is centred around discovery and relaxation. Families are drawn to attractions such as the Orchidarium and Selwo Safari Park, while the town’s open-air murals have created a unique cultural identity. Its beaches, including the sheltered Playa del Cristo, are well suited to children and families. Dining options are increasingly varied, with traditional chiringuitos complemented by a new wave of restaurants and boutique hotels.
Estepona’s services are strong, though on a smaller scale than Marbella – and of course, Marbella is just 25 minutes away by car should you be missing anything. There are international schools and modern medical centres, while the town’s size makes life straightforward and accessible. Many residents value the sense of community and the balance between quality services and a more intimate lifestyle.
The pace of life in Estepona is slightly more sedate and rooted in everyday traditions. It is a town where people connect easily and where the Mediterranean lifestyle feels both natural and unhurried. Estepona is ideal for those who want authenticity and a more laid-back existence without being far from the more dynamic attractions of Marbella.
